Preheat your oven to 450°F (232°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and set aside.
Wash the potatoes thoroughly under cold water. Pat them dry with a kitchen towel.
Cut each potato into wedges: slice each potato in half lengthwise, and then slice each half into 3 to 4 wedges, depending on the size of the potato.
Place the potato wedges in a large bowl. Drizzle them with olive oil and toss to coat each wedge evenly.
In a small bowl, mix together the garlic powder, paprika, dried oregano, black pepper, and salt.
Sprinkle the seasoning mix over the potato wedges, and toss them again to ensure the seasoning evenly coats each wedge.
Place the seasoned wedges on the prepared baking sheet in a single layer, making sure they do not overlap for even cooking.
Bake in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es, or until the wedges are crispy and golden brown, turning them halfway through the cooking time using a spatula.
Remove the wedges from the oven and let them cool for a few minutes.
Transfer the wedges to a serving platter and garnish with fresh chopped parsley before serving.
